Output 512285c331f71bbbe4c2fee7e43b8e5b8a64b1b223f9767e08433455630289da:1

value
6677743
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2da56e5ba39e17ffd97e8adf4f7e3c655882b776 OP_EQUALVERIFY OP_CHECKSIG
address
15AMazAxo5uoHciJMUDdVAyCNsHuuF4pVH
transaction
512285c331f71bbbe4c2fee7e43b8e5b8a64b1b223f9767e08433455630289da
spent
true